Rajasthan Royals opener Yashasvi Jaiswal continued his remarkable run of form, scoring a brilliant 175 against the West Indies in the ongoing Test match. The young left-hander showcased exceptional maturity and control, featuring 22 boundaries in his innings before being dismissed due to a run-out misunderstanding.
Jaiswal's monumental knock places him among an elite group, becoming one of the youngest players globally to register five scores of 150 or more before turning 24, matching the achievement of former South African captain Graeme Smith. His consistency in converting starts into massive totals has drawn high praise from cricketing legends.
During a lighthearted moment, West Indies great Brian Lara humorously pleaded with the young batsman to ease up on the opposition bowlers, underscoring the dominance Jaiswal displayed at the crease. This performance further solidifies Jaiswal's reputation as a prolific scorer and a cornerstone of India's future batting lineup.
